IA SF289 | 2023-2024 | 90th General Assembly

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 1-0)
Status: Introduced on February 15 2023 - 25% progression
Action: 2023-03-29 - Subcommittee recommends amendment and passage. [].
Pending: Senate Ways and Means Committee
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

A bill for an act modifying the sales tax holiday by extending the holiday and including emergency preparedness supplies.
